1. A method of dispensing wine using a wine storage device, the method comprising:
comparing a storage temperature of a storage space of the wine storage device and a preset dispensing temperature of the wine;
when a difference between the storage temperature and the preset dispensing temperature is greater than or equal to a preset value, circulating the wine from a wine bottle in the a storage space to a temperature adjustment module, and operating at least one of a heater or a cooler included in the temperature adjustment module to adjust a temperature of the wine; and
dispensing, through a dispensing head, the wine changed to have the preset dispensing temperature while circulating through the at least one of the heater or the cooler of the temperature adjustment module,
wherein the heater comprises at least two heating pipes connected to each other to form a closed loop path, and
wherein a valve is coupled to the at least two heating pipes and is controlled such that the wine passes through only one of the at least two heating pipes or is controlled such that the wine passes continuously circulate through the at least two heating pipes.
